I have a box of marine pure ceramic balls in my sump. My last BRS purchase came with a free gift of a box of maxspect’s ceramic balls. I have space but is there any other downside of putting them in my sump? Can you have too much?
 
The only concern I have is ”white media” often contains aluminum which can release into the tank. I’m not sure if it’s a problem or not for tank inhabitants, I don’t know how much will leach, and I also don’t know if there’s a point when the aluminum stops leaching.

That being said, I recently added 5lbs of seachem matrix, which is another type of white media, to my tank. The potential for aluminum is a concern for me, but I’ve seen some great tanks with the same media.

I recently sent out an ICP test to see if the aluminum level is fine or not in my tank.

What were the results of ICP?
 
@K9Fish

Aluminium 1,8 µg/l < 40 µg/l

Aluminum is low. (good)
